WebDec 17, 2009 · My HMO covered my Optifast pre-op, but that's because the bariatric surgeon wanted me to lose 10% of my weight prior to surgery, so it was deemed "medically necessary." I didn't even have a copay. Overview of the Program The program has two key components. WebThe OPTIFAST® program, which usually lasts 26 weeks, is a medically-supervised weight-management program that closely monitors and assesses progress towards better health and emotional well-being. The program utilizes a meal replacement plan that transitions to self-prepared ‘everyday’ meals, in conjunction with comprehensive patient ...
